Adjective[edit]
existenceless (not comparable)
- Without existence.
- 1973, Oliver Sacks, Awakenings:
- Before this, she was almost existenceless, 'asleep'; following this, whatever her tribulations and complications, she has been firmly awake, and most passionately and gratefully back in the world.
